Output 376e8975630b7e4afebb03bc0e0f36cdfdf99173ab817c87ee637914a04c96f8:36

value
120029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e154edf6384ebaa62175822eee3bbe8228304d6 OP_EQUAL
address
3QrV5nG4TfbAPXqeCkznkQWWrCWaqX39fA
transaction
376e8975630b7e4afebb03bc0e0f36cdfdf99173ab817c87ee637914a04c96f8
spent
true